My Friend Pedro’s Bananimated Launch Trailer
Sat 22-06-2019 21:34 | Nintendo Switch News
Developer Deadtoast Entertainment and Devolver Digital action sidescroller is now available on Switch via eShop! My Friend Pedro can now be downloaded via eShop for USD 19.99. To celebrate its release, the team have especially...













